Free children’s clinic at the Healing Arts Center throughout March

Array

Christopher Evans, LMP, will be offering a free movement clinic for children ages three to 13 at the Healing Arts Center on Mondays throughout March.

Evans, a licensed massage practitioner at The Healing Arts Center, has been training in the Anat Baniel Method (anatbanielmethod.com) for the past three years. He is certified with 560 hours of ABM training and an additional 162 hours of training specific to special needs children. The Anat Baniel Method, based on the work of Moshe Feldenkrais, is a cutting edge approach to treating developmental disorders. ABM is founded on the understanding that many diseases and traumas of childhood interrupt the normal and spontaneous process of brain pattern formation, interfering with the communication necessary between the child’s body, the world around it, and the child’s brain. The Anat Baniel Method works to directly communicate with the nervous system of the child in gently ways, primarily through movement, enhanced awareness and non-verbal kinesthetic experiences.

Some of the conditions that ABM work may be useful for are autism spectrum disorders, birth trauma, brain injury, cerebral palsy, ADD, learning disorders, tactile sensitivities, and ADHD.

Parents will be asked to accompany their child and observe the 30-minute lesson held in a private treatment room. Five appointments will be available each Monday in March in the afternoon. Walk-ins are welcome if the space is available, but it is strongly recommended to sign up ahead of time. In celebration of Evans’ recent graduation from the Anat Baniel Method for children, these lessons will be given free of charge.
